Effects of doping on thermally excited quasiparticles in the high-$T_c$ superconducting state

arXiv:cond-mat/9910098 · doi:10.1103/PhysRevB.61.6343

Abstract

The physical properties of low energy superconducting quasiparticles in high- $T_c$ superconductors are examined using magnetic penetration depth and specific heat experimental data. We find that the low energy density of states of quasiparticles of La$_{2-x}$Sr$_x$CuO$_4$ scales with $(x-x_c)/T_c$ to the leading order approximation, where $x_c $ is the critical doping concentration below which $T_c=0$. The linear temperature term of the superfluid density is renormalized by quasiparticle interactions and the renormalization factor times the Fermi velocity is found to be doping independent.
